Morgan Sindall Group Plc is seeking a motivated Site Agent to work on the Mill Lane/ Bishopsgate Network Rail project. This role involves managing site activities, ensuring compliance with health & safety, and delivering projects on time and within budget.

The ideal candidate will have relevant qualifications and proven civil engineering experience, especially with structures and rail projects. Opportunities for growth and development are available in a collaborative environment. Generous benefits including flexible working and a contributory pension scheme are offered.
